Preferred term

Eye Evisceration  

Type

  • Topical Descriptor

Note

  • do not confuse with EYE ENUCLEATION ("removal of eyeball leaving eye muscle & remaining orbital contents intact") or ORBIT EVISCERATION ("removal of contents of orbit, including eyeball, blood vessels, muscles, fat, nerve supply & periosteum")

Scope note

  • The surgical removal of the inner contents of the eye, leaving the sclera intact. It should be differentiated from ORBIT EVISCERATION which removes the entire contents of the orbit, including eyeball, blood vessels, muscles, fat, nerve supply, and periosteum.
